Shares of American Healthcare REIT, Inc. (NYSE:AHR – Get Free Report) gapped down before the market opened on Tuesday . The stock had previously closed at $55.47, but opened at $53.25. American Healthcare REIT shares last traded at $52.83, with a volume of 1,905,124 shares trading hands.

American Healthcare REIT Stock Down 5.2%
American Healthcare REIT (NYSE:AHR –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, August 6th. The company reported $0.16 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.14 by $0.02. American Healthcare REIT had a net margin of 4.84% and a return on equity of 3.63%. The business had revenue of $674.25 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$645.30 million. During the same period in the previous year, the firm posted $0.42 earnings per share. American Healthcare REIT’s revenue for the quarter was up 24.3% compared to the same quarter last year. American Healthcare REIT has set its FY 2026 guidance at 2.150-2.190 EPS. Sell-side analysts anticipate that American Healthcare REIT, Inc. will post 2.17 EPS for the current fiscal year.

About American Healthcare REIT
American Healthcare REIT, Inc (NYSE: AHR) was a publicly traded real estate investment trust focused on acquiring, owning and managing healthcare‐related properties across the United States. The company’s portfolio spanned senior housing communities, skilled nursing facilities, medical office buildings and outpatient care centers, all operated under long‐term net lease or triple‐net lease structures designed to provide stable, predictable rental income.
Employing a strategy of partnering with established healthcare operators, American Healthcare REIT targeted properties in both major metropolitan areas and high‐growth secondary markets to capitalize on demographic trends such as an aging population and increased demand for outpatient services.
